•What You'll Do
Depending on your background and interests, you may contribute with a dedicated project in areas such as:
• Materials Development: Characterise recovered fibers and test their integration into new composite materials (mechanical, thermal, morphological analysis).
• Process Chemistry: Support development of chemical processing for resin removal or polymer recycling. This may involve lab-scale reactions, purification, and material separation.
• Composites Engineering: Help develop processing methods for integrating reclaimed fibers into thermoplastics or thermosets (e.g., prepregging, compression moulding, infusion).
• Pilot Trials & Scale-Up: Assist in preparing and running scale-up tests, including process design, sampling, and analysis.
• Digital, Data & Reporting: Analyse lab data, model, prepare internal reports, and support technical communication with partners.

Uplift360
Uplift360 develops cutting-edge chemical recycling technology to recover and reuse advanced materials, reducing waste and promoting sustainability. Focused on automotive, renewable energy and defence industries, we enable a circular economy for high-performance composites and critical materials.
